<< I have a lot of friends
 in Florida who do very well with rebloomers, some as far
 south as St. Augustine.  Raised beds, providing good drainage,
 other good culture habits, and probably plant selection or
 buying from region growers are other opportunities for success. >>

Claire,
      I would like to hear a lot more on this.  I am farther south than St. 
Augustine, but over here toward the west, we have colder winters and are 
often drier.  Too dry frequently.  What are some of the rebloomers that are 
doing well in St. Augustine area?
